Health Canada has published a consumer product recall regarding thousands of beds sold in Canada via Wayfair.
The government agency says that the affected beds can pose an injury hazard.
Why you should care: According to the recall, there have been reports about certain low profiles beds from Home Design Inc. of the beds breaking, sagging, or collapsing during use, posing an injury hazard to the user.
The affected products include:
- Aadvik Tufted Upholstered Low Profile Standard Beds, part number 80002
- Bellaire Tufted Upholstered Low Profile Platform Beds, part number 80053
- Carlie Tufted Upholstered Low Profile Standard Beds, Forsan Tufted Upholstered Low Profile Platform Beds, part number 80055
- Drusilla Tufted Upholstered Low Profile Standard Beds, part number 80032
- Forsan Tufted Upholstered Low Profile Platform Beds, part number 80071
What they’re saying: "The products were sold on Wayfair.ca and the part number can be found on the assembly instructions that came with the product, the packaging, and should also be in the order confirmation," says the recall.
"Consumers should immediately stop using the recalled beds and contact the Home Design, Inc. for free replacement slats and side rails for consumer installation."
ICYMI: The affected products were sold from July 2018 to November 2023 and 55,847 units were sold in Canada.
"As of January 8, 2024, the company has received 22 reports of beds failing in Canada and 4 reports of injuries," says the government.
